Transaction 6c6016c2c8841292eef1e4f4a2aed3513541b5d7f6ade17bb99d3e5d50df8eb7

12 Input
1 Outputs
  • 6c6016c2c8841292eef1e4f4a2aed3513541b5d7f6ade17bb99d3e5d50df8eb7:0
  • value  1131505835
    address  3HrbHABfS1CwTamWbrHYNyJEqnnCReSdKp